Current evidence for cannabidiol (CBD) topicals in neuropathic pain management remains limited to preclinical animal studies demonstrating potential anti-inflammatory and endocannabinoid system modulation, with no robust clinical trials in human populations to date. While mechanistic data from rodent models suggest CBD may influence inflammatory signaling pathways relevant to nerve pain, these findings cannot be reliably extrapolated to clinical efficacy or safety in patients. The lack of human clinical evidence, standardized formulations, and regulatory oversight of topical CBD products creates a significant gap between consumer expectations and scientific validation. Clinicians should counsel patients that while CBD topicals are widely marketed for neuropathic pain, recommending them remains premature without evidence-based clinical trials establishing efficacy, optimal dosing, and safety profiles in human subjects. Patients interested in CBD topicals should be informed that current marketing claims substantially outpace the available scientific evidence and that conventional or evidence-based treatments remain the appropriate first-line approaches for nerve pain management.

🧠 While preclinical studies in animal models suggest that CBD topicals may modulate inflammatory pathways relevant to neuropathic pain, the translation to human clinical efficacy remains uncertain and understudied. Current evidence for CBD topicals in nerve pain consists primarily of mechanistic work in rodents and small, often uncontrolled human observations, making it difficult to distinguish genuine therapeutic benefit from placebo effect or spontaneous improvement. Healthcare providers should be aware that topical CBD products are marketed with varying concentrations and formulations, few are rigorously standardized, and absorption through intact skin remains poorly characterized, introducing significant variability in what patients may actually be receiving.
